Chef Jason, The Kitchen at Middleground Farms

Jason Kline

Chef and Culinary Artist

Jason has been passionate about cooking for at least a decade now, with teaching becoming a more recent and unexpected joy. The idea of teaching hadn’t really crossed his mind until he heard about The Kitchen, but it turns out he really loves it.

In all seriousness and relatability hunger was the spark of his inspiration. Growing up with parents who weren’t the greatest cooks, Jason was encouraged to try everything, fostering his love for a wide range of foods. As family dinners became repetitive, he sought out new culinary experiences.

His favorite part about what he does is not just the freshness of the farm ingredients or the opportunity to work with diverse cuisines and techniques, but the simple pleasure of making delicious food and sharing it with happy people.
